What is Native Interactions Framework:
-
[]Native Interactions Framework (NIF) allows modders to easily place supported interactions in the game world
[
]No need to edit files or scenes by hand, everything is done through an in-game UI[]Offers 21 unique interactions
[]Also offers interactions which interact with the environment, such as sitting and controlling the TV
[]Creations can easily be shared and be made part of your mod

Native Interactions Framework is a gameplay mod that lets players place interactions like sitting, sleeping, drinking, and showering in the world. With 6,099 endorsements and nearly 785,000 downloads, it's a popular tool for adding immersive activities. Last updated January 2026, it remains actively maintained.
